Physical Therapist Assistant

Associate of Applied Science

  • Entry wage: $43,829*
  • Median wage: $57,715*
  • Job placement rate: 98%**

A day in the life

A physical therapist assistant (PTA) works under the supervision of a licensed physical therapist. The profession requires working closely with patients in settings such as outpatient clinics, hospitals and skilled nursing facilities. The job is physically demanding. Excellent critical thinking skills and people skills are essential.

Three reasons to consider this program.

  1. Your work improves people's lives. Imagine helping someone learn to walk again.
  2. Roane State has outstanding facilities for PTAs.
  3. Starting salaries for PTAs are good, and the job outlook is strong.

Before you sign up, make sure you understand...

  1. The final year is academically challenging and is three full-time semesters.
  2. You must be comfortable putting your hands on patients. PTAs have physical contact with patients.
  3. Admission is competitive. The typical GPA for accepted students is above 3.5, and only 20 spots are available.
